From the SKILL.md

# HAMA焦虑排除判定规则 依据汉密尔顿焦虑量表(HAMA)总分阈值(<7分),在HAMA施测合规且效度可信前提下,系统性排除焦虑障碍共病,支撑单轴抑郁工作诊断决策。 ## Prompt 当HAMD确认重度抑郁(如总分≥24)且HAMA已规范施测、效度指标有效(如L/F量表无异常)时:提取HAMA总分;若总分<7分,则判定为‘无焦虑状态,可排除焦虑症’;该结论须以完整语句形式明确记录于个案概念化文档‘2.2评估与诊断’节,作为诊断依据链组成部分,并终止焦虑专项干预路径。 ## Objective 防止因焦虑症状漏判导致的抑郁单轴诊断误用 ## Applicable Signals - HAMA总分<7分 - 临床观察无显著焦虑行为表现(如坐立不安、过度担忧、躯体主诉集中于焦虑维度) ## Contraindications - HAMA未施测、施测不完整或存在严重作答效度问题(如随机作答、矛盾条目高分) - 存在未控制的甲状腺功能亢进、心律失常等可致焦虑样症状的躯体疾病 ## Workflow Steps - 1. 确认HAMA施测合规性及效度指标有效(含L/F量表核查) - 2. 提取HAMA总分 - 3. 比对阈值:总分<7 → ‘无焦虑状态’;总分≥7 → 进入焦虑共病评估流程 - 4. 在个案概念化中明确书写结论句:‘HAMA总分X分(<7),无焦虑状态,可排除焦虑症’ - 5. 将该结论归入诊断依据链,支撑单轴抑郁工作诊断 ## Constraints - 必须同步核查HAMA效度量表(如L、F量表)以排除装病或随意作答 - 不得将HAMA单项高分(如‘紧张’‘害怕’)单独作为焦虑存在依据,须依赖总分阈值 ## Cautions - HAMA对青少年焦虑敏感性有限,若来访者有回避表达、躯体化倾向或语言发展滞后,需结合行为观察与照料者访谈交叉验证 - 分数临界(如6分)不视为安全排除,应标注‘焦虑可能性低,暂不诊断,持续监测’ ## Output Contract - 书面结论语句:‘HAMA总分<7分,无焦虑状态,可排除焦虑症’,含具体分值、判定依据(HAMA总分阈值标准)及诊断意义说明(支撑单轴抑郁工作诊断),存档于个案概念化文档‘2.2评估与诊断’节 ## Files - `references/evidence.md` - `references/evidence_manifest.json` ## Triggers - HAMD总分≥24(提示重度抑郁) - 需鉴别焦虑是否共病 - HAMA已规范施测且结果可信
